Categorías
código abierto Mundo 2.0 programación WordPress

Nuevo formato de menús para WP 3.6

menus-36

Categorías
código abierto Mundo 2.0 programación WordPress

Adiós, post-formats, adiós

Con mucha pena nos toca decir en esta semana adiós con la manita a los post-formats en WordPress 3.6. Muchos comentaron en la Meetup de WP Marbella que el nuevo formato de tumblrización de WordPress no les gustaba, y en el chat de este miércoles se tomó la decisión de apartarlos del core.

Post-formats

Aparte de que esto pueda quedar muy chulo, si hubiera aparecido por el año 2008 o 2009 casi todos los desarrolladores habrían dicho al unísono esto es territorio plugin. Se nota que la fiebre del diseño y del UI/UX ha calado hondo, y en algunas cosas somos ahora más flexibles ;).

Aunque se pierda esta barra, como comentaba antes, pasará a ser un plugin tal y como comenta Mark Jaquith en este artículo. Lo que se saca del sistema es la UI (Interfaz de Usuario) que veis arriba, quedando en el sistema parte de la codificación. ¿Por qué se hace esto? Porque los formatos de entrada, como la imagen destacada por ejemplo, ya son utilizados por casi todos los temas disponibles. Por tanto, se ha decidido mantenerlos tal y como estaban antes de 3.6, y los temas podrán mostrar los distintos formatos de otra forma.

post-formats-2 Decimos adiós a la interfaz «bonita» de los formatos de entrada, pero no decimos adiós a los formatos, que seguirán dependiendo de los temas tal y como lo han hecho hasta ahora.

Qué es un formato de entrada

Es una forma de mostrar una entrada. Teniendo el mismo contenido, podemos mostrar la información de distintas formas. No es lo mismo que un Custom Post Type (CPT, tipo de datos), donde definimos un nuevo tipo de datos adaptado a nuestras necesidades, con nuevos campos, relaciones taxonómicas…

Por qué creo que esta decisión es buena

No ya tanto porque sea territorio plugin, sino porque se va viendo un espíritu colectivo de hacer que WordPress.org sea y siga siendo algo independiente de WordPress.com, donde este modelo de publicación posiblemente será un estándar.

Por otro lado, si se convierte en estándar en WP.com, me gustaría ver esta interfaz de publicación como módulo en la próxima versión de Jetpack.

Categorías
código abierto Mundo 2.0 programación WordPress

Herramientas para trabajar con Responsive

Si estás profundizando en Resposive Design, estas herramientas te pueden ser útiles.

Categorías
código abierto Mecus Mundo 2.0 WordPress

Probando software en EBEuskadi’13

Hace unos días, Luis me planteó crear un nuevo sistema de control de acceso para EBE Euskadi, así que el equipo se puso manos a la obra, y empezamos a trabajar.

Lo primero que hicimos fue esbozar y esquematizar sobre papel qué queríamos conseguir con el sistema, y cuál sería la interacción del usuario con el mismo. Y,  con usuario, nos referíamos tanto al asistente como al validador de la entrada. Una vez tuvimos todas las vistas, todo lo que teníamos esbozado pasó a programación, y de ahí a producto final.

Como no puede ser de otra forma, nuestro producto es íntegramente WordPress ;). Os lo cuento.

entrar

El usuario, cuando se da de alta en el sistema, recibe un QR en su correo, junto con el enlace de su entrada. Ese QR, que le enviaremos en un recordatorio también un día antes del evento, le dará acceso a su perfil de usuario para editarlo.

Si quien lee ese QR es un usuario validador (utilizamos User Access Manager para controlar los perfiles), verá el mensaje que se muestra en la parte superior. De esta forma, validará el acceso del usuario al evento.

Si el QR es leído una segunda vez, nos encontraremos con una pantalla distinta, en la que tendremos marcado cuándo se efectuó la entrada del usuario, y quién fue el validador.

ya-ha-entrado

Para estos dos ejemplos hemos modificado el QR (y, evidentemente, el texto), que abre la página de EBE EuskadiNo vais a entrar en el perfil de Íñigo si lo probáis ;).

Pensando en EBE 13, hemos añadido también unas cuantas commodities. Dependiendo del perfil de cada usuario aparecerán distintas opciones, y ayudará a que la organización sea mucho más eficiente.

commodities

Esta modificación la hemos realizado sobre Camptix. Camptix es un plugin que conocemos bastante bien, ya que es el que se utiliza de forma oficial en todas las WordCamps, y hemos participado en dos de sus últimas actualizaciones. Ofrece una gestión completa de perfiles a través de URL privadas con cadenas aleatorias, haciendo que no sea necesario el registro del usuario en WordPress y aumentando su comodidad. Unido al acceso por QR, el sistema se vuelve mucho más usable y funcional. Y, además, cuenta con pasarela de pago en caso de necesitarla para formalizar tus ventas de entradas.

Eso ha hecho que, quitando la página de opciones, todo esto que veis se haya realizado con una modificación no demasiado grande. Estamos orgullosos del trabajo, de lo poco que pesa el plugin, de la velocidad de funcionamiento, y en dos días lo probaremos en vivo :).

Categorías
código abierto

San Francisco

Photo by Thomas Hawk

Hoy andamos de camino a San Francisco, camino de nuevo de la WordCamp. Nuestro vuelo ya debe estar en el aire, y nosotros, nubes volcánicas mediante, debemos estar deseando llegar a Nueva York para hacer el transbordo.

Si por casualidad también estás en San Francisco y has ido como acompañante, o te quieres escapar un rato, hay un evento alternativo a la WordCamp. ¡Nada menos que un Geeknic de Software Libre!

Categorías
código abierto

Usando Git

Estoy empezando a probar Git.

Cosas que necesitaré más adelante y tengo que guardar:

  cd existing_git_repo
  git remote add origin git@github.com:user/project.git
  git push origin master

¿Quieres saber más de Git? Echa un vistazo en su página.